Application for accident benefits deemed withdrawn after applicant abandoned proceedings; applicant ordered to pay $1,000 in expenses.
The applicant failed to attend scheduled pre-hearings and ceased communicating with his counsel regarding his claim for statutory accident benefits.
The insurer brought a motion to dismiss the application without a hearing, and the applicant's counsel moved to be removed as representatives of record.
The arbitrator granted the counsel's motion to be removed.
Rather than dismissing the claim as frivolous or vexatious, the arbitrator deemed the application withdrawn under Rule 70 of the Dispute Resolution Practice Code.
The applicant was ordered to pay $1,000 in expenses to the insurer due to his failure to participate.
Andrei Fedoseev, Jr. v. RBC General Insurance Company, 2006 ONFSCDRS 189
